Bug Description
trying to boot 64bit desktop image from http://
on Macbook 4,1 fails. After selecting cd to boot from, it spins up but i only get a blinking cursor, cd stops moving after some time. nothing ever happens.

This bug is still happening in the Release Candidate for me. I am able to boot the 32 bit live cd flawlessly, however the amd64 will not post after 'install ubuntu' or 'run without installing.'
Keyboard is unresponsive, no video, no audio. Nothing but a blinking cursor and a blank screen. I have tried all the options given from the F6 prompt, as well as removing spash and quiet. Even with that, I get no verbosity.
